Bisaul village is located in the Hanumannagar Subdivision of the Darbhanga district in Bihar .

Bisaul village has a total population of 1,859 people, of which 974 are males and 885 are females.
The literacy rate of Bisaul village is 39.16%. Male literacy stands at 46.00% and female literacy at 31.64%.
There are approximately 320 households in Bisaul village.
Darbhanga (19 km) is the nearest town to Bisaul village for major economic activities and is located approximately 19 km away.
The population of Bisaul village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 448 | 280 | 728 |
| Illiterate | 526 | 605 | 1,131 |
| Total | 974 | 885 | 1,859 |
Source: Census 2011
